// © 2017 and later: Unicode, Inc. and others.
// License & terms of use: http://www.unicode.org/copyright.html#License
package com.ibm.icu.impl.number;
import com.ibm.icu.impl.StandardPlural;
import com.ibm.icu.impl.number.PatternStringParser.ParsedPatternInfo;
import com.ibm.icu.text.CurrencyPluralInfo;
public class CurrencyPluralInfoAffixProvider implements AffixPatternProvider {
private final AffixPatternProvider[] affixesByPlural;
public CurrencyPluralInfoAffixProvider(CurrencyPluralInfo cpi) {
affixesByPlural = new ParsedPatternInfo[StandardPlural.COUNT];
for (StandardPlural plural : StandardPlural.VALUES) {
affixesByPlural[plural.ordinal()] = PatternStringParser
.parseToPatternInfo(cpi.getCurrencyPluralPattern(plural.getKeyword()));
}
}
@Override
public char charAt(int flags, int i) {
int pluralOrdinal = (flags & Flags.PLURAL_MASK);
return affixesByPlural[pluralOrdinal].charAt(flags, i);
}
@Override
public int length(int flags) {
int pluralOrdinal = (flags & Flags.PLURAL_MASK);
return affixesByPlural[pluralOrdinal].length(flags);
}
@Override
public String getString(int flags) {
int pluralOrdinal = (flags & Flags.PLURAL_MASK);
return affixesByPlural[pluralOrdinal].getString(flags);
}
@Override
public boolean positiveHasPlusSign() {
return affixesByPlural[StandardPlural.OTHER.ordinal()].positiveHasPlusSign();
}
@Override
public boolean hasNegativeSubpattern() {
return affixesByPlural[StandardPlural.OTHER.ordinal()].hasNegativeSubpattern();
}
@Override
public boolean negativeHasMinusSign() {
return affixesByPlural[StandardPlural.OTHER.ordinal()].negativeHasMinusSign();
}
@Override
public boolean hasCurrencySign() {
return affixesByPlural[StandardPlural.OTHER.ordinal()].hasCurrencySign();
}
@Override
public boolean containsSymbolType(int type) {
return affixesByPlural[StandardPlural.OTHER.ordinal()].containsSymbolType(type);
}
@Override
public boolean hasBody() {
return affixesByPlural[StandardPlural.OTHER.ordinal()].hasBody();
}
}
